About powerups. if you place them on a map, they can be picked up when a probe/drone/SCV is nearby. Is it possible to keep the powerups where they are, even when a probe/drone/SCV is near them?
So what I mean is, make powerups unable to be picked up by those units.

I answered this on Maplantis first, so I'll just go ahead and give you the same answer:
Making it a disabled sprite makes it unpickup-able, but then you can walk through it, disabling a unit cloaks it, but it cannot be picked up, the best method is to run the Junk Yard Dog AI on it, then it cannot be picked up.

Quote from okeee
if a SCV is carrying a powerup, how can you make him release it? Without killing the SCV or destroying the powerup..
What you do:
-Remove the powerup
-Create a large unit (the Ultralisk will do) at a sealed off, special location
-Move that Ultralisk to the desired SCV
-Create the new powerup at the Ultralisk's location and remove the Ultralisk (that was it won't bee close enough for the SCV to pick it up again)

Two fun facts to remember about powerups:
-While a worker is carrying a powerup, the powerup will respond to conditions as if it was owned by the owner of the worker carrying it
-While a worker is carrying a powerup, only actions for the ORIGINAL owner of the powerup can effect it. In other words, if a P1 SCV picked up a P2 powerup, it can be removed only with "Remove powerup for P2" action (and categories like All Players, because P2 is included in that category)
